Bean Burgers #1


INGREDIENTS:

3 c Cooked beans (kidney or
-pinto beans are good)
1 md Onion, finely chopped
1 lg Potato, cooked
2 lg Tomatoes, chopped
2 ts Chopped thyme
-(or 1 scant teaspoon dry)
3/4 c Breadcrumbs or whole-wheat
-flour
Salt to taste
Pepper to taste


Mix all the ingredients thoroughly, either in a food processor or with a potato masher. The cooked beans should be mashed, not pureed, and the mixture should form into balls easily. If the mixture is too wet, add a little more breadcrumbs or flour. Form the mixture into eight burgers and place them on a lightly greased baking tray. Bake at 350'F. for 45 minutes, turning them over after 30 minutes. Place the burgers inside buns ("Eating In" also includes a recipe for whole-wheat buns) and top with fried onions, lettuce, tomato, pickles, or whatever your taste dictates. Each burger contains: 352 calories, 0 cholesterol, 1 gram fat, 20 grams protein.
